>Can anyone tell me what is wrong with the following basic hack? When I run
>this with the line "handled = oldTrap(event)" commented out, it runs but
>consumes the event, as you would expect. If I un-comment that line, I get
>the "Fatal Error" dialog and a reset for my troubles.
>
>This is a copy of the sample code from the HackAPI html with the change to
>make it handle FldHandleEvent(FieldPtr fld, EventPtr event). I'm using CW5
>and the 0xA13B.rsrc from the traps.zip published on www.roadcoders.com.
>This seems too simple to be causing these kind of problems! What am I
>missing?
>
>#include <Pilot.h>
>
>#define myCreator 'test'
>#define myResID 1000
>
>Boolean MyFldHandleEventTrap(FieldPtr fld, EventPtr event);
>
>Boolean MyFldHandleEventTrap(FieldPtr fld, EventPtr event)
>{
> Boolean (*oldTrap)(FieldPtr, EventPtr);
> DWord value;
> Boolean handled = false;
>
> // Get the old trap address from HackMaster.
> FtrGet(myCreator, myResID, &value);
>
> // Set the procedure pointer and initialize
> oldTrap = (Boolean (*)(FieldPtr, EventPtr))value;
>
> // Test - something more significant will be added here ...
> SndPlaySystemSound(sndWarning);
>
> // If not handled, call the old routine
> if (!handled) {
> //handled = oldTrap(fld, event); <-- This seems to be the problem line
> }
>
> return handled;
>
>}
